Ride-Strong.com I’ve been meaning to get a post up about this site for some time and I’m just now getting around to it.

Ride-Strong.com is a fairly new site but you wouldn’t know it by looking at it. They have a lot going on over there.

  1. T-Shirt Give Aways
  2. Colnago Carbon bike give away
  3. If you send them a shirt or some swag from your shop or site they will do a write up about it and then give away your logo stuff to readers. So you get double exposure.
  4. Great cycling articles as well.

Ride-Strong.com’s creator Tyler Ford left his job as a loan officer at a bank to build up RoadBikeRides.com and Ride-Strong.com. He also sponsors two Tucson Arizona cycling teams.

Tyler has done a great job building this site and I’m sure it will continue to grow. So head over there and try to win a bike, a shirt, or some other swag.
